A High Accuracy Variant of The Iterative Alternating Decomposition Explicit Method for Solving The Heat Equation
We consider three level difference replacements of parabolic equations focusing on the heat equation in two space dimensions. Through a judicious splitting of the approximation,the scheme qualifies as an alternating direction implicit (ADI) method. Using the well known fact of the parabolic-ellipti...
